Pat’s Fest 2012

Pat's Fest

The mostly annual summer shindig at Pat’s In The Flats rocked the industrial section of Tremont this past Saturday that included 10 bands: [in order of appearance] Prisoners, Filmstrip, Ragers, Tinko, Founding Fathers, Uno Lady, Little Bighorn, Wooly Bullies, Obnox and All Dinosaurs, that finished the night with an exclamation point.

When Pat’s Fest works, it is one of Cleveland’s best summer local music events and this was one of those days it worked. Much of the credit has to go to Tony Cross, whom booked the best lineup that I’ve witnessed at previous Pat’s Fests. Tony and his brother Nick also helped bar-tend after their band Little Bighorn performed a rousing set and then stayed late to help with the clean up. As with many of Pat’s Fests, people are always happy to lend a hand to someone that is beloved in the scene. Thanks, Pat!
